Anyone who has used Twitter to any extent has seen or used "hashtags"

They are simply a key-word or phrase of acronym preceded with a #.  An example is #Followback

People can search out and capture "hashtags" and do!

It is the way that people can receive messages from users that they do not follow and send messages to those who do not follow them!

Moreover...there are applications that allow for the simply identification of key words or phrases and the consolidation of those "tweets" in a timeline!

TweetDeck and www.86u2.com have this functionality...

Both management applications also allow the user to follow the individual who used the phrase or key word...

Many Twitter users (who are subject oriented) communicate across the Twitter world simply by using "hashtags!

  1. With Twitter...Simply go to the menu-bar item "#Discover" and you'll be taken to a new page...in the search bar...type the hashtag you are searching for... Try it with #TMTM

    In TweetDeck you can create a "New Column" and have it only search out and list a specific hashtag...

    In www.86u2.com the application called Twitter Mining allows you to search out hashtags, keywords and phrases. It lists users that have tweeted them and the phrase. You can then follow them or send a tweet with the corresponding hashtag.

  2. One other neat item under Twitter's #Discover is a list of Trending or most frequently hashtags and key words/phrases. Many individuals will use the trending hashtag and send messages to those using the hashtag!
